Isuzu next-generation bakkie programme, South Africa

6th December 2019

By: Sheila Barradas

Creamer Media Research Coordinator & Senior Deputy Editor

     

Font size: - +

Name of the Project
Isuzu next-generation bakkie programme.

Location
South Africa.

Project Owner/s
Isuzu Motors South Africa, a subsidiary of Isuzu Motors of Japan.

Project Description
Isuzu Motors of Japan plans to increase the company’s bakkie production capacity to 29 000 units a year.

The next-generation bakkie will be locally engineered to meet the requirements of the South African and key sub-Saharan Africa markets.

Potential Job Creation
About 1 000 jobs are expected to be created at the plant.

Capital Expenditure
R1.2-billion.

Planned Start/End Date
No date has been announced for the introduction of the vehicle.

Latest Developments
The project was announced in November.

Key Contracts and Suppliers
None stated.

On Budget and on Time?
Not stated.
